普通程序员转型大数据开发需要考虑哪些因素?
大数据领域已成为众多程序员的热门转型方向,其带来的薪酬优势更是吸引了大批程序员投身其中。在中国顶尖的互联网公司中,大数据开发人员的薪酬比同级别的其他职位高出30%以上,平均年薪高达20万。如此诱人的待遇,使得许多程序员纷纷选择向大数据开发领域转型。要想成功转型,并非易事。市场环境虽然良好,但普通程序员需要考虑诸多因素。
一、转型需要付出努力,半途而废只会一事无成。许多程序员在不脱产的情况下试图完成转型,虽然这并非不可能,但对于大多数普通程序员来说却是一项挑战。我们都需要学会舍得,放弃之前的旧知,追求更高的境界。切记不要朝三暮四,否则只会临渊羡鱼,无法真正获得高薪和实现转型。
二、转型大数据开发需要具备强大的IT开发能力。熟悉SQL语言,拥有一定的SQL性能优化经验是基础中的基础。熟练掌握Java语言、MapReduce编程以及脚本语言Shell/Python/Perl之一也是必不可少的技能。还需要具备强大的业务理解能力,对数据和新技术的敏感度要高,对云计算和大数据技术充满热情。只有这样,才能在大数据领域事半功倍。
三、选择适合的学习方式也是关键。学习大数据并非一蹴而就,需要花费较长的时间。目前Java和大数据的学习时间都需要4-5个月。想要快速进入大数据领域并完成转型的程序员,可以选择参加大数据培训班,这将更加便捷。
四、年龄并不是限制。许多程序员担心自己即将30岁,现在转行是否已晚。实际上,在IT行业,30-40岁的支柱型人才比比皆。对于一个30岁的人来说,正值壮年,未来的职业发展道路仍然漫长。在国内地铁上,甚至可以看到老阿姨在学习Java,年龄并不是问题。
DT时代的到来让人们措手不及,但大数据领域的人才缺口巨大。目前大学的专业课程刚刚开设,第一批人才还需要四年时间才能输出。这对于普通程序员来说是一个机会。现在学习大数据必将开启高薪职业生涯的新篇章。
作者链接:
- 上一篇:Sentinel配置限流教程:入门级实践指南
- 下一篇:返回列表
版权声明:《普通程序员转型大数据开发需要考虑哪些因素?》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/28294.html